XRP Whales Withdraw $231M Amid $28M ETF Inflows
XRP's recent price action has left market participants wondering if it marks the beginning of a broader sell-off or a consolidation phase before the next leg higher.
The cryptocurrency rose sharply by 53% in the past week, closing at $1.50, but this week saw a 7% pullback, pushing the price back toward $1.40.
A closer look at the chart reveals several potential warning signs, with XRP being one of the few major cryptoassets to record a loss this week, while others like Solana have already recorded gains of over 6%.
The recent whale activity around XRP has split the market, with some arguing that the large sell-off is just another market manipulation attempt by whales, while others believe it's consistent with accumulation.
A key factor in determining whether XRP breaks $1.5 could be the latest whale move spotted by CryptoQuant, where 231 million XRP was withdrawn from Binance to another address in one transaction, constituting the largest withdrawal in six months.
